14 Lifetime Disability Benefit €300,000 (Payable in addition to any other benefit)
    A single identifiable occurrence on the field of play resulting in permanent total physical paralysis such that the Insured Person is confined to a wheelchair for life.

  (i) Capital Benefits
  Permanent Total Disablement from gainful employment up to €100,000
  Loss of eye(s) or limb(s), or loss of hand(s) or foot/feet up to €100,000
  Complete and incurable paralysis up to €100,000
  Permanent Partial Disablement ("Continental Scale")
  A scale of benefits providing for benefits to a maximum of €50,000 for specified disabilities applies. Details are available on request.

  (ii) Death Benefit
  Adult (or Married Youth) €50,000
  Youth €25,000
  (Where the cause of death is solely attributable to accidental, visible and violent means, in the course of a match or training session double benefit will be paid).

15 Medical
  Otherwise unrecoverable medical expenses up to a maximum of €5,000. The first €60 of each and every claim is not covered. Medical treatment is only covered if provided by recognised/qualified practitioners.
(i) Physiotherapy, Osteopathy, Chiropractic, Sports Massage, Acupuncture etc. must be medically prescribed and are limited to €200 in total per claim. Medically prescribed post operative treatment is exempt from the limit of €200 and will be considered separately as part of a medical expenses claim.

16 Dental
  Otherwise unrecoverable dental expenses up to a maximum of €5,000. The first €60 of each and every claim is not covered.

17 Supplementary Hospital Benefit
  €400 per day's stay in hospital. Benefit only payable if stay is a minimum of 10 consecutive days up to a maximum of 15 days.

18 Loss of Wages(Applicable (a) to Adults and (b) to Youths who are in full-time employment). 'Employment' means permanent gainful employment of not less than 16 hours a week.
  Otherwise unrecoverable loss of basic nett wages (i.e. excluding overtime, bonuses, unsociable working hours, allowances etc.) payable up to 52 weeks but excluding the first week
 

Social Welfare and /or other entitlements will be considered as recoverable income and will be deducted from the basic nett wage figure.

Benefit is payable for full weeks only and the maximum benefit payable per week is as follows:

    WEEK 1 NIL
    WEEKS 2-4 UP TO €200
    WEEKS 5-52 UP TO €400

NOTE

The injury scheme is funded entirely from Club and GAA funds with no outside (e.g.insurance) involvement. There is no legal obligation on the GAA to provide such a scheme. Risk is an inherent factor in sport, as in life. When members voluntarily take part in Club Activities, they accept the risks that such participation may bring. Legal representation is not required and there is strictly no Legal Expenses Cover amongst the benefits provided.

  For information purposes only. It does not form any contract and does not purport to deal with all aspects of the GAA Injury Scheme.
